64-401 – Act, how cited.

64-401. Act, how cited. Sections 64-401 to 64-420 shall be known as the Online Notary Public Act. Source Laws 2019, LB186, § 1; Laws 2021, LB94, § 1.

64-408 – Types of online notarial acts.

64-408. Types of online notarial acts. The following types of online notarial acts may be performed by an online notary public: (1) Acknowledgments; (2) Jurats; (3) Verifications or proofs; and (4) Oaths or affirmations. Source Laws 2019, LB186, § 8.

64-301 – Act, how cited.

64-301. Act, how cited. Sections 64-301 to 64-317 shall be known and may be cited as the Electronic Notary Public Act. Source Laws 2016, LB465, § 1.
